Parent Council meeting
The first meeting of the new format Parent Forum – the term now describing all parents with pupils at the School – was held on Tuesday 11th September. The main purpose of this first Forum meeting was to explain the purpose and operation of the new Parent Council and to seek volunteer members. It is hoped that most of those who came along will attend the first Parent Council meeting and become its initial members, along with some members of the previous School Board who have offered to join the new body to provide some continuity and experience of issues at the School. This would then give us at least two parent representatives for each school year, in line with the target set in the new Parent Council’s constitution. The new 2007/08 academic year sees the Government’s parental involvement legislation taking full effect. Under this legislation parents of pupils at the school are to be known collectively as the Parent Forum. The Parent Forum has the right to form a new Parent Council which will replace the current School Board. At Peebles High School we hope to ensure that the new Parent Council will provide wider representation of parental views by amongst other things seeking two parents from each school year for membership of the Council. This will also hopefully improve continuity over future years. A copy of the constitution of the new Parent Council has been sent to all parents and you will also find a copy in this section of the school website. You will see from this that we plan to continue the successful PTA as a permanent sub-committee of the new Council and also plan to form a new Communications permanent sub- committee as this is an area that is always capable of further development and improvement.
